Comprehensive Guide to Peritoneal Dialysis Consent

What is the Consent for Peritoneal Dialysis?

The Consent for Peritoneal Dialysis serves as a critical form in the dialysis process, outlining the patient's understanding and agreement to undergo this treatment. This consent form plays an essential role in ensuring that individuals are fully informed about their treatment options, potential risks, and procedural details. Obtaining consent for medical procedures not only protects patient rights but also establishes a legal framework that safeguards healthcare providers.

Purpose and Benefits of the Consent for Peritoneal Dialysis

This medical consent form offers protection for both patients and healthcare teams by ensuring that all parties are aware of the treatment's nature and implications. Through comprehensive information about the procedure, patients can make informed decisions regarding their health. The legal implications of signing the consent include acknowledgment of possible risks, procedural details, and responsibilities, which form a binding agreement essential in healthcare.

Who Needs to Complete the Consent for Peritoneal Dialysis?

Several key roles require signing the consent form, including the patient, a witness, and a physician. Each of these individuals plays a critical role in the peritoneal dialysis process. Furthermore, patients must meet specific eligibility criteria to participate in this treatment; understanding these roles and criteria ensures a collaborative and legally sound healthcare environment.

Renewal Process for the Consent for Peritoneal Dialysis

The renewal process for the consent for peritoneal dialysis is required annually to maintain its validity. Patients should initiate this process well in advance of treatment renewals to avoid potential complications. Failing to renew the consent form on time could lead to interruptions in treatment or legal challenges for both patients and healthcare providers.
